09:41 — Breaker on the Varrow pricing API tripped after upstream p99 hit 8s. Korbel gateway returned cached quotes per fallback policy. 09:47 — Upstream recovered; breaker stayed open due to misconfigured half-open probe interval (600s, should be 60s). 09:58 — Config hotfixed, breaker closed, traffic normal. Customer impact: stale prices for ~17 minutes, no errors surfaced. Action item: add alerting on breaker state transitions in the Korbel dashboard. Reference trace for the incident is below.

session token of kahif-kageg = htk14_01cd78718aea51

Onboarding note for the Ledgerpane admin table: bulk edits are applied through the batcher service, not directly against the database. Select rows, choose an action, and the batcher stages changes in a pending set you can review before commit. Edits over 500 rows require a second approver — this is enforced server-side, so don't try to chunk around it. To run the batcher locally you need the staging write credential, which goes in your .env as the next line.

secret setting of bahip-kagag: RELAY_SECRET3=c83

Step 4 — Shipping Driftpane (our big-file diff viewer)

Build the chunked-rendering bundle first; Driftpane streams diffs in 2MB slices, so don't skip the worker assets or huge files will just spin forever. Run the smoke test against the 500MB fixture in the perf folder — if scrolling stutters, bump the slice cache before releasing. When everything passes, you're ready to sign the artifact. Paste the deploy key below so the uploader can authenticate.

deploy key for kagup-bageg: bky4_6i6U

## GC Pauses — Matchline Service

When Matchline's order-matching JVM hits long garbage-collection pauses, pairing latency spikes above 400ms and the watchdog restarts the pod. Before restarting manually, capture a heap summary with the collector script in ops/tools. If pauses persist, enable the low-pause collector profile by editing the service's env file on the affected node. Add the profile unlock token on the next line.

sealed setting: ARCHIVE_KEY3=8d0